The second issue of the Carpathian Socio-Cultural Review

The second issue of the Carpathian Socio-Cultural Review published as part of the project "The world of Carpathian rosettes - actions to preserve the cultural uniqueness of the Carpathians" co-financed by the Poland-Belarus-Ukraine Cross-border Cooperation Program 2014-2020.

This issue of the "Carpathian Socio-Cultural Review" presents other places. attractive for tourists in Ukraine and Podkarpacie. So we have the next text from the series of fortresses and palaces of the former Kresy, this time Żółkiew and Złoczów, so closely related to the history of the First Polish Republic. It is worth taking a look at the text about a group of motorcyclists organizing trips to the Eastern Carpathians and visiting them on two-wheelers ... on the peaks. We also show "Carpathian Stories", that is people who, while working in the Bieszczady Mountains, discover and maintain craftsmanship and historical traditions. We are also starting a series of materials about the Hutsuls and the Hutsul regions, one of the most interesting - perhaps not only artistically - groups of Eastern Carpathian highlanders, who cultivate their traditions to this day.
